Analysis

The most recent figure for secondary education, general pupils in Pacific island small states is 50.0%, measured in 2018.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 0.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, secondary education, general pupils in Pacific island small states peaked at 50.3% in 2000 and was at its lowest, 46.7%, in 1970.

Pacific island small states ranks 5th of 41 groups on this measure, in the top 10%.
